Sometimes people in abusive situations think they’re responsible for the other person’s happiness or that they’re going to fix them and make them feel better. The practice of equanimity teaches that it’s not all up to you to make someone else happy.

Sharon Salzberg
About This Quote

The practice of equanimity teaches that it’s not all up to you to make someone else happy. You can’t make someone feel everything you think they should feel, they can only accept it or reject it. Making them happy is not your responsibility.

Source: Real Love: The Art Of Mindful Connection
